Atomic Museum
The National Atomic Testing Museum (Atomic Museum) is a space to learn about America’s nuclear weapons testing program. Showcasing artifacts like a nuclear reactor, a backpack nuke, and many more, visitors can reflect on the history of atomic testing.

Boulder City, Nevada
Drive time: 45 minutes
- Hoover Dam: Learn about the Hoover Dam and its history through a tour of the dam and power plant.
- Lake Meade: Lake Meade has water activities, but you can also visit the Historic Railroad Trail to see the huge tunnels that once delivered construction supplies to the Hoover Dam.
St. George, Utah
Drive time: 2 hours
- Snow Canyon State Park: Snow Canyon State Park is located in the Red Cliffs Desert Reserve and features the canyon, as well as the extinct Santa Clara Volcano, lava tubes, lava flows, and sand dunes.
- Zion National Park: The Zion National Park is a nature preserve in Utah that features forest trails along the Virgin River, Emerald Pools, waterfalls, and a Zion Narrows Wading Hike.
Laughlin, Nevada
Drive time: 1.5 hours
- Don Laughlin’s Riverside Resort: From pools and spas to arcades and museums, you’ll find your way to rest and relaxation at this resort destination.
- Mojave Resort Golf Club: Golf Digest gives this resort 4 stars for its 18-hole championship course on the banks of the Colorado River.

Don’t Miss These Seasonal Events!
We’re sharing 5 seasonal events taking place in Las Vegas that you won’t want to miss.
- NASCAR Weekend: Held at the Las Vegas Motor Speedway each spring, NASCAR favorites race around the iconic tri-oval track.
- HallOVeen at the Magical Forest: You’ll find family-friendly rides, attractions, and elaborate decorations at Opportunity Village for this Halloween event.
- Asian Lantern Festival: The Desert Breeze Events Center hosts the Asian Lantern Festival each fall, featuring light displays, street foods, and cultural experiences.
- Wrangler National Finals Rodeo: The National Finals Rodeo, happening in December, brings in rodeo competitions and country music events.
- Holiday performances, light displays, and shows. Check out the Smith Center for the Performing Arts for The Nutcracker performances and hotel locations through the strip for elaborate light displays and shows.
